Working Principles

The BU92001KN-E2 operates on the principle of voltage regulation. It compares the output voltage with a reference voltage and adjusts the internal circuitry to maintain a stable output voltage, regardless of variations in the input voltage or load conditions. This ensures that the connected electronic devices receive a consistent and reliable power supply.
